
Hawaii is the closest US state to Australia, with a distance of approximately 5,100 miles between the two. Its geographical location in the central Pacific Ocean, northeast of Australia, makes it significantly closer than any mainland US state. For example, the distance between Honolulu, Hawaii and Sydney, Australia is much shorter than the distance between Los Angeles, California and Sydney.

Australia is in the Southern Hemisphere
Hawaii, a US state located in the central Pacific Ocean, is the closest American state to Australia. It is situated approximately 5,100 miles from Australia, which is a significantly shorter distance than between mainland US states and Australia.
Australia, on the other hand, is in the Southern Hemisphere and spans latitudes from about 12°S to 43°S. It has a unique culture and geography, with the Northern Territory offering the quintessential Australian experience, including sublime landscapes, emblematic wildlife, and authentic Aboriginal culture. Queensland, known as the 'Sunshine State', is a subtropical stretch of land in the northeast of Australia, boasting the Great Barrier Reef, the ancient Daintree Rainforest, and the Whitsunday Islands.
While there are no US states in the Southern Hemisphere, comparisons can be drawn between certain states in the two countries. For example, Sydney is often likened to New York City, Queensland's Gold Coast to Florida, and Fremantle to San Francisco. Additionally, Queensland has been referred to as Australia's California, though some argue it more closely resembles Alabama politically and culturally.
In summary, while the United States does not share the Southern Hemisphere with Australia, Hawaii is the closest American state geographically, and cultural and political similarities can be observed between various Australian and US states.
